Shortening days in Nicolás Romero through August 1897

Daylight shortens through August 1897 in Nicolás Romero, Mexico, moving from 12h 59m on the first days to 12h 30m on the last — a swing of about 29 minutes. That works out to roughly 7 minutes a week.

Look for the year's local extremes here: sunrise as early as 05:36 on August 1 and as late as 05:44 on August 28, with sunset from 18:15 (August 31) to 18:36 (August 1).
